0tokens

Topic / how to start tech startup in india

How to Start Tech Startup in India: The Ultimate 2024 Guide

A technical guide on how to start tech startup in India, covering legal incorporation, DPIIT registration, choosing a tech stack, and securing early-stage funding.


The Indian startup ecosystem is currently the third-largest in the world, boasting over 100 unicorns and a rapidly maturing infrastructure for deep-tech and AI innovations. Starting a tech company in India is no longer just about building services; it is about building scalable products for a global market while leveraging a massive domestic internet user base.

However, moving from a concept to a sustainable tech business requires navigating specific regulatory frameworks, funding landscapes, and technical talent pools. This guide provides a technical and operational blueprint on how to start a tech startup in India, focusing on the essentials of company formation, compliance, and scaling.

1. Ideation and Problem-Market Fit

Before registering a company, you must validate that your technical solution solves a "hair-on-fire" problem. In the Indian context, successful tech startups usually fall into two categories:

  • India-First Solutions: Solving local challenges like UPI-based fintech, agritech for fragmented landholdings, or vernacular AI models.
  • Global SaaS/Deep-Tech: Building in India to serve the US or European markets, leveraging the cost-arbitrage of engineering talent.

Validation Framework:

  • MVP Development: Use low-code tools or rapid prototyping to test your core hypothesis.
  • Customer Discovery: Speak to at least 30 potential stakeholders to understand procurement cycles and pain points.

2. Choosing the Right Legal Structure

For a tech startup, the legal structure impacts your ability to raise venture capital.

  • Private Limited Company (Pvt Ltd): This is the gold standard for tech startups. It allows for equity dilution, issuance of ESOPs, and is preferred by Institutional Investors (VCs).
  • Limited Liability Partnership (LLP): Suitable for bootstrapped businesses with lower compliance costs, but VCs rarely invest in LLPs because they cannot easily hold shares.
  • Incorporation Process: You will need to obtain a Digital Signature Certificate (DSC), Director Identification Number (DIN), and file the SPICe+ form on the Ministry of Corporate Affairs (MCA) portal.

3. Registering with Startup India (DPIIT)

Registering your startup with the Department for Promotion of Industry and Internal Trade (DPIIT) is a critical step. Recognition provides:

  • Tax Holidays: Eligibility for a 3-year income tax exemption under Section 80-IAC.
  • Self-Certification: Compliance under 9 environmental and labor laws through simple self-certification.
  • IPR Benefits: Up to 80% rebate on patent filings and 50% on trademark filings.
  • GeM Portal: Access to government procurement opportunities specifically reserved for startups.

4. Building the Technical Architecture

In the early stages, speed of iteration is more important than perfect scalability. However, your stack should be chosen based on the availability of talent in India.

  • Cloud Choice: AWS and Google Cloud offer massive credits (often up to $100k) for early-stage startups.
  • Tech Stack: JavaScript (Node.js/React) remains the most popular due to the abundance of talent. For AI/ML-heavy startups, Python is the industry standard.
  • Data Residency: If you are in Fintech or Healthtech, ensure your architecture complies with India’s Digital Personal Data Protection (DPDP) Act, which mandates local data storage for specific sensitive datasets.

5. Hiring Tech Talent and Equity Distribution

India produces over 1.5 million engineers annually, but the competition for "top 1%" talent is fierce.

  • Co-founder Search: Look for a CTO or CEO who complements your skill set. Sites like LinkedIn or niche startup events in Bengaluru, Gurgaon, and Pune are ideal.
  • ESOPs (Employee Stock Option Plans): To attract senior talent when you lack cash, offer ESOPs. Ensure you have an ESOP pool of 10-15% carved out during incorporation.
  • Outsourcing vs. In-house: Build your core product in-house. Outsource secondary functions like UI/UX design or administrative software if necessary.

6. Navigating the Funding Landscape

How you fund your tech startup depends on your stage of growth:

  • Bootstrapping: Using personal savings. Ideal for reaching the MVP stage.
  • Angel Investors: High-net-worth individuals who provide "seed" capital. Networks like Indian Angel Network (IAN) or Let’s Venture are prominent.
  • Grants: For AI and deep-tech founders, grants are the best way to maintain 100% equity. Programs like MeitY’s TIDE 2.0 or specialized AI grants provide non-dilutive capital.
  • Venture Capital: For scaling. Top-tier VCs in India include Sequoia (Peak XV), Accel, and Elevation Capital.

7. Intellectual Property and Compliance

Tech startups must protect their code, algorithms, and brand.

  • Trademarks: Fast-track your brand registration through the Startup India scheme.
  • Patents: If you have a unique technological process or AI architecture, file a provisional patent immediately.
  • Annual Returns: Ensure timely filing of AOC-4 (Financial Statements) and MGT-7 (Annual Return) with the ROC to avoid heavy penalties or "struck-off" status.

8. Scaling and Go-to-Market (GTM)

Once you have an MVP and initial users:

  • B2B Startups: Focus on LinkedIn outreach and content marketing.
  • B2C Startups: Leverage India's UPI ecosystem for seamless payments and use WhatsApp Business API for customer engagement, as it has the highest penetration in India.

Frequently Asked Questions (FAQ)

Q1: How much does it cost to register a tech startup in India?
The government fee and professional charges for a Private Limited Company usually range between ₹15,000 to ₹25,000, depending on the authorized capital.

Q2: Can a single person start a tech startup?
Yes, via a One Person Company (OPC). However, for a venture-scale startup, it is highly recommended to have at least two directors to meet the requirements of a Private Limited Company.

Q3: Which city is best for a tech startup in India?
Bengaluru is the "Silicon Valley of India" for talent and VC access. Delhi-NCR (Gurgaon/Noida) is excellent for B2B and Fintech, while Mumbai is the hub for Financial services.

Q4: Is a patent necessary for a software startup?
While you cannot patent "code" in India, you can patent a "technical contribution" or an "invention" that uses software to solve a problem. Most tech startups rely on "Trade Secrets" and Copyright for their source code.

Apply for AI Grants India

If you are an Indian founder building the next generation of Artificial Intelligence, don't let capital hold you back. At AI Grants India, we provide non-dilutive funding, mentorship, and cloud credits to help you scale your technical vision. Apply today at https://aigrants.in/ and join the elite community of Indian AI pioneers.

Building in AI? Start free.

AIGI funds Indian teams shipping AI products with credits across compute, models, and tooling.

Apply for AIGI →